Best Quotes about Life

1.
The supreme irony of life is that hardly anyone gets out of it alive.
Robert Heinlein

2.
Life is full of surprises and and serendipity. Being open to unexpected turns in the road is an important part of success. If you try to plan every step, you may miss those wonderful twists and turns. Just find your next adventure-do it well, enjoy it-and then, not now, think about what comes next.
Condoleeza Rice

3.
To find the point where hypothesis and fact meet; the delicate equilibrium between dream and reality; the place where fantasy and earthly things are metamorphosed into a work of art; the hour when faith in the future becomes knowledge of the past; to lay down one's power for others in need; to shake off the old ordeal and get ready for the new; to question, knowing that never can the full answer be found; to accept uncertainties quietly, even our incomplete knowledge of God; this is what man's journey is about, I think.
Smith, Lillian

4.
Life is not a dress rehearsal.
Tremain, Rose

5.

6.
A life of ease is a difficult pursuit.
Cowper, William

7.
New York, the nation's thyroid gland.
Morley, Christopher

8.
Real generosity toward the future lies in giving all to the present.
Camus, Albert

9.
Life must be lived and curiosity kept alive. One must never, for whatever reason, turn his back on life.
Roosevelt, Eleanor

10.
I used to trouble about what life was for -- now being alive seems sufficient reason.
Field, Joanna

11.
The city is loveliest when the sweet death racket begins. Her own life lived in defiance of nature, her electricity, her frigidaires, her soundproof walls, the glint of lacquered nails, the plumes that wave across the corrugated sky. Here in the coffin depths grow the everlasting flowers sent by telegraph.
Miller, Henry

12.
Life is a state of mind.
Warden, Jack

13.
It is quite true what Philosophy says: that Life must be understood backwards. But that makes one forget the other saying: that it must be lived --forwards. The more one ponders this, the more it comes to mean that life in the temporal existence never becomes quite intelligible, precisely because at no moment can I find complete quiet to take the backward-looking position.
Kierkegaard, S°ren

14.
We live, not as we wish to, but as we can.
Menander of Athens

15.
Even when I'm sick and depressed, I love life.
Rubinstein, Arthur

16.
When in Rome, do as Rome does.
Bierce, Ambrose

17.
Life is not always not always what one wants it to be., but to make the best of it as it is the only way of being happy.
Churchill, Jennie Jerome

18.
The city as a center where, any day in any year, there may be a fresh encounter with a new talent, a keen mind or a gifted specialist -- this is essential to the life of a country. To play this role in our lives a city must have a soul -- a university, a great art or music school, a cathedral or a great mosque or temple, a great laboratory or scientific center, as well as the libraries and museums and galleries that bring past and present together. A city must be a place where groups of women and men are seeking and developing the highest things they know.
Mead, Margaret

19.
Life is a dead-end street.
Mencken, H. L.

20.
The energy of the mind is the essence of life.
Aristotle

21.
Life in the twentieth century is like a parachute jump; you have to get it right the first time.
Mead, Margaret

22.
Attack life, it's going to kill you anyway.
Coallier, Steven

23.
The average person living to age 70 has 613, 000 hours of life. This is too long a period not to have fun.

24.
A city is a place where there is no need to wait for next week to get the answer to a question, to taste the food of any country, to find new voices to listen to and familiar ones to listen to again.
Mead, Margaret

25.
Life, we learn too late, is in the living, the tissue of every day and hour.
Leacock, Stephen B.

26.
Life is short and we have never too much time for gladdening the hearts of those who are travelling the dark journey with us. Oh be swift to love, make haste to be kind.
Amiel, Henri Frederic

27.
There are four things every person has more of than they know; sins, debt, years, and foes.
Proverb, Persian

28.
Dare to err and to dream. Deep meaning often lies in childish plays.
Schiller, Johann Friedrich Von

29.
The dream crossed twilight between birth and dying.
Eliot, T. S.

30.
Not where I breathe, but where I love, I live; Not where I love, but where I am, I die.
Southey, Robert

31.
Life is a succession of lessons enforced by immediate reward, or, oftener, by immediate chastisement.
Dimnet, Ernest

32.
May God bless you to live as long as you want to; and want to as long as you live!
Proverb, Scottish

33.
A free life cannot acquire many possessions, because this is not easy to do without servility to mobs or monarchs...
Epicurus

34.
I'm impressed with the people from Chicago. Hollywood is hype, New York is talk, Chicago is work.
Douglas, Michael

35.
Not only is life a bitch, but it is always having puppies.
Gusoff, Adrienne

36.
Life is but a game and we are the playthings of the gods.

37.
It's better to be an authentic loser than a false success, and to die alive than to live dead.
Markiewicz, William

38.
To live is not breathing it is action.
Rousseau, Jean Jacques

39.
Life's tragedy is that we get old too soon and wise too late
Franklin, Benjamin

40.
Who goes to Rome a beast returns a beast.
Proverb, Italian

41.
Life must be lived forward, but can only be understood backwards.
Kierkegaard, S°ren

42.
What a life! True life is elsewhere. We are not in the world.
Rimbaud, Arthur

43.
The tragedy of life is not so much what men suffer, but rather what they miss.
Carlyle, Thomas

44.
Life has taught me that it is not for our faults that we are disliked and even hated, but for our qualities.
Berenson, Bernard

45.
I have never felt salvation in nature. I love cities above all.
Michelangelo

46.
Feelings are really your GPS system for life. When your supposed to do something, or not supposed to do something, your emotional guidance system lets you know.
Oprah Winfrey

47.
Prepare for death, if here at night you roam, and sign your will before you sup from home.
Johnson, Samuel

48.
Life -- No, I've nothing to teach you about it for the moment. May be writing about it another week.
Forster, Edward M.

49.
Life is what we make it, always has been, always will be.
Moses, Grandma

50.
Living Life Tomorrow's fate, though thou be wise, Thou canst not tell nor yet surmise; Pass, therefore, not today in vain, For it will never come again.
Khayyam, Omar
